Since the trade: the stock's move from the trade date to the latest close we hold, as of Sep 7, 2026, an estimate, with the S&P 500 over the same window and the difference against it. The figures describe the stock after the trade, not the member's result: the filing carries a band, not a fill, and a sale keeps the same sign, so a positive figure after a sale means the stock kept rising. An option row carries the underlying stock's move. A row marked n/a has no market price. Not investment advice.

How to read a STOCK Act filing
WHAT THE FILING ACTUALLY SAYS
Congress rows disclose a value range rather than an exact amount, and the STOCK Act allows up to 45 days to report. Full sourcing and the limits of this data are on the methodology page. A filing is a record of a transaction, not a signal, and nothing here is investment advice.
